    Shark Tank is an American reality television show that features aspiring entrepreneurs pitching their business ideas to a panel of wealthy investors. The show provides a platform for innovators and inventors to showcase their products or services and receive funding and mentorship from successful business leaders. Each episode includes a series of presentations, where contestants present their ideas, negotiate with the investors, and seek financial backing in exchange for a percentage of their company. Shark Tank encourages entrepreneurship, provides valuable insights into the world of business, and offers entertaining and educational content for viewers of all ages.

Steve Tisch Biography
Steven Elliot Tisch, born February 14, 1949, is an American film producer and businessman. He serves as the chairman, co-owner, and executive vice president of the New York Giants, the NFL team co-owned by his family. Tisch is also involved in the film and television industry as a producer. Born in Lakewood Township, New Jersey, he is the son of former Giants co-owner Preston Robert Tisch. Tisch attended Tufts University, where he began his filmmaking career. Notably, he produced films such as Outlaw Blues (1976) and Risky Business (1983), which starred Tom Cruise in his first leading role. Tisch also produced the made-for-TV movie The Burning Bed (1984).
